Ira and Ambi met at the Rotunda at 7 p.m. and went to Fig on the Corner.

Ambi: [I had] never been on a blind date — I didn’t have any expectations.

Ira: My first impression was that she’s pretty and dressed well. She had really nice shoes.

Ambi: [When I got there] Ira was already there — I was about five minutes late. I walked over and introduced myself. Ira seemed nice.

Ira: I asked her if she liked food and she said yes. Some friends of mine recommended Fig, so I asked her and she was okay with [it].

Ambi: I think Ira wanted to try something new, so I was fine [going] to Fig.

Ira: First [the conversation] was introductions and the usual major questions. There were some lulls, but there were some interesting things I learned about her.

Ambi: To be honest, I don’t think personally Ira and I got along too well. Ira seemed very nice but more of a social person or extrovert and I’m more of an introvert.

Ira: I felt [like] the talking was pretty balanced. She likes the NBA, she would date LeBron James if presented with the opportunity, she cooks at 4 a.m. and she’d never heard of Key & Peele.

Ambi: I felt like the conversation was pretty even. He did salsa dancing, which I found really surprising because I [don’t] know a lot of guys interested in dance. We both like dogs.

Ira: We split the check — she offered early on to go dutch.

Ambi: [The date had] more of a friendly vibe. Ira made a few Jewish references that I didn’t get.

Ira: At the end of the date, I pulled her aside and asked her how it went. I was completely honest and asked her what she thought of the date and what I did wrong. That was a great moment because we both said we weren’t a match and we were both completely honest there. It wasn’t really forced under a date setting anymore.

Ambi: We’re probably not going to hang out again. If I seem him, I’ll say hi. We both agreed that we didn’t have much chemistry and that we should just be Facebook friends.

Ira: I’d rate the date an 8 — she’s really nice and [it will be] nice to see another familiar face on Grounds.

Ambi: I’ll rate the date an 8.5.
